Molecular Weight [Da] | Molecular Weight Maximum [Da] | Comment | Organism |
---|---|---|---|
24300 | 25500 | gel filtration, MW depending on purification procedure | Enterobacter sp. |
28500 | 31500 | sucrose density gradient centrifugation, MW depending on purification procedure | Enterobacter sp. |

Storage Stability | Organism |
---|---|
-20°C, 0.1 mg protein per ml Tris-HCL elution buffer, stable for about 3 weeks | Enterobacter sp. |
-20°C, lyophilized enzyme, stable for about 3 weeks | Enterobacter sp. |

Temperature Stability Minimum [°C] | Temperature Stability Maximum [°C] | Comment | Organism |
---|---|---|---|
55 | - |
for 15 min, 100% activity | Enterobacter sp. |
65 | - |
for 15 min, 78-80% activity depending on purification procedure | Enterobacter sp. |
75 | - |
for 15 min, 53-57% activity depending on purification procedure | Enterobacter sp. |
85 | - |
for 15 min, 18-20% activity depending on purification procedure | Enterobacter sp. |
100 | - |
for 15 min, total loss of activity | Enterobacter sp. |
